The museum houses an impressive collection of art work, and includes the famous Kansas City shuttlecock sculptures on the front and back lawns of the museum. It is truly a gem of Kansas City. Admission is free except for certain exhibits. It is open until 9 PM on Fridays and 10am to 5pm on Saturdays and Sundays. You can also dine at the wonderful Rozzelle Court located inside the museum.
Not only is this America's official World War I museum and memorial (and home to the most comprehensive collection of WWI objects in the world!), but it also provides the most popular and arguably the best view of downtown Kansas City. Explore the museum, walk the grounds, take in the views, and, if you're feeling brave, head up to the top of the tower (to reach the top, guests ride an elevator and climb 45 steps).
